Output 63d39d718187958a15d288fe96d6e76347c8a22c6612334655dcd01a3cd61827:1

value
1612637
script pubkey
OP_0 OP_PUSHBYTES_20 d356c06cfc831f203e1628c53e454e951a1c0c11
address
bc1q6dtvqm8usv0jq0sk9rznu32wj5dpcrq36snu0d
transaction
63d39d718187958a15d288fe96d6e76347c8a22c6612334655dcd01a3cd61827
spent
true